How DoorKing Products Fail - and How We Fix Them

DoorKing builds solid operators, but every line has its known failure points. Here’s what we see on Humble properties, year after year.

  • DoorKing 9150 slide-gate limit switches drifting out of position. This series uses mechanical limit nuts on a threaded shaft, and the Texas heat plus daily cycling causes them to walk. The gate stops mid-travel or slams the end stop. We reset the limits, check the shaft for play, and photograph the final position so the next adjustment is a five-minute job instead of a re-diagnosis.
  • DoorKing 6002 swing-gate capacitor failure after 5-7 years. A dead capacitor means the motor hums but won’t move the gate. DIY forums blame the motor, and some companies quote a full replacement. It’s usually a $25-$45 capacitor. We test with a meter first, replace the part, and you keep your original motor.
  • DoorKing 6050/6100 control board relay burn-out from power surges. Humble gets hard summer storms, and a nearby lightning strike doesn’t have to hit your house to cook a relay. Symptoms include the gate opening but not closing, or the auto-close feature failing. We install a surge protector on the board with every replacement and move the board to a cleaner connection point.
  • DoorKing battery back-up (models 9150-081 and 6050-081) swollen or dead after two years of heat exposure. Humble’s garage-mounted operators see ambient temperatures above 120°F in August, which kills lead-acid batteries early. We test the battery under load, not just by voltage, because a weak battery reads fine until the gate actually draws current.
  • DoorKing telephone-entry system (1837 and 1835) keypads with sun-faded, cracked faceplates. The electronics inside are usually fine, but water gets behind the cracked faceplate and corrodes the ribbon cable to the keypad. We clean or replace the ribbon, install a weather cover, and document the board condition so you can see what’s actually failing.

What DoorKing Gate Repair Costs in Humble

Here’s what we actually charge on DoorKing jobs in Humble, as of 2025. These are flat prices, not estimates, and they include the diagnosis, labor, and parts. The most common service call we run is a limit-switch reset with a full tune-up, at $185 flat. A capacitor replacement runs $225-$275 including the part and testing. A control board replacement on a DoorKing 9150 or 6050 runs $450-$700 depending on whether you need the OEM DoorKing 9150-055 board or a quality refurbished unit. A complete swing-gate motor replacement (when the motor itself is truly dead, not just the capacitor) runs $650-$900 installed. What moves the price is the age of the operator, whether the wiring is in conduit or exposed, and whether the board needs upgrading for modern safety features.
